Designates April 29, 2026, as Denim Day
Official: A resolution recognizing April 29, 2026, as "Denim Day" and honoring survivors of sexual assault.

What does this resolution do?
1. This resolution honors survivors of sexual assault by recognizing a specific day for awareness. 2. Denim Day encourages people to wear denim as a symbol of support for survivors. 3. The resolution aims to raise public awareness about the impact of sexual assault. 4. It promotes discussions about consent and the importance of supporting survivors.
